Trial Outcomes & Findings for the Effect of Dopamine on Mechanical Ventilation Induced Lung Injury (NCT NCT03317431)

NCT ID: NCT03317431

Last Updated: 2018-10-22

Results Overview

ImageJ software were used to get the Integrated Optical Density(IOD) of the chemiluminescent signal from the membranes of dopamine receptor 1(DRD1). The normalization was carried out by DRD1 IOD/total β-actin IOD for sample loading correction. In determination of the expression level of DRD1 in different time points, the investigators had a bulk preparation of normal placental protein which was set as a control. Analyze the correlation between duration of mechanical ventilation and DRD1 expression. If p value is less than 0.05, then its change is statically significant.

PRIMARY outcome

Timeframe: 20min-60min

ImageJ software were used to get the Integrated Optical Density(IOD) of the chemiluminescent signal from the membranes of dopamine receptor 1(DRD1). The normalization was carried out by DRD1 IOD/total β-actin IOD for sample loading correction. In determination of the expression level of DRD1 in different time points, the investigators had a bulk preparation of normal placental protein which was set as a control. Analyze the correlation between duration of mechanical ventilation and DRD1 expression. If p value is less than 0.05, then its change is statically significant.

Outcome measures

Outcome measures
Measure
Ventilation
n=46 Participants
patients undergoing selective operation with general anesthesia(GA) and mechanical ventilation(MV) mechanical ventilation: mechanical ventilation protocol: tidal volume 6-8 ml/kg, positive end-expiratory pressure 5 cmH2O, oxygen concentration 40%; respiratory rate 10-15/min, inspiratory/expiratory ratio 1:1.5.
Correlation Coefficient (r) Between Duration of Mechanical Ventilation and DRD1 Expression
-0.555 pearson Correlation Coefficient
